Warning Signs You Need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al
Catching warning signs early on can save you a lot of money and prevent bigger problems down the line. So what are some signs you might need hydrostatic pressure water removal?
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ign of water damage or mold growth. Don’t ignore it – our team can help you identify the source of the odor and address it before it becomes a bigger issue.
Warped or Discolored Flooring
If you notice your flooring is warped or discolored, it could be a sign of water damage. Our team can help you assess the situation and develop a plan to repair or replace the damaged areas.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or moisture issues. Our team can help you identify the source of the problem and develop a plan to address it.
Unusual Stains or Water Marks
Unusual stains or water marks on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age or leaks. Don’t ignore it – our team can help you identify the source of the issue and address it before it becomes a bigger problem.
Mold Growth or Black Spots
Mold growth or black spots on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age or moisture issues. Our team can help you identify the source of the problem and develop a plan to address it.
